We're seeking a highly skilled and motivated System Administrator to join our team, responsible for maintaining system administration support activities for a large, complex network environment with geographically distributed systems. As a key member of our team, you'll play a critical role in ensuring the smooth operation of our systems, supporting solutions for system engineering requests, and upgrading and maintaining capabilities.
Key Responsibilities
- Install, administer, and troubleshoot systems, applications, and processes, ensuring timely resolution of issues and optimal performance
- Manage and maintain complex server enclaves, including analyzing system scanning reports, patching, cert renewals, vulnerability management assessments, and active directory configurations
- Identify and correct hardware and software issues, responding to system administration, operations, and maintenance problems, and developing re-work solutions
- Create and maintain documentation of complex server/network environments, ensuring clear, concise, and accurate information is readily available for incident resolution
- Collaborate with users and external support personnel regarding system outages and upgrades, and confer with upper management regarding recommended resolution options

Required Education, Experience, & Skills- Must have at least 8 years of relevant experience.
- Must have experience as a systems administrator providing direct support to end users and technical staff (developers, testers, engineers, etc.).
- Must be proficient with Windows Server 2012R2, 2016, 2019, and Active Directory.
- Must have experience with Linux and Microsoft-based servers and workstations.
- Must have experience with Windows 2019.
- Must have experience with OS and Application Hardening to include DISA, Best Practices, and High Assurance environments.
- Must have experience with software/hardware deployment, patches, and operating systems, and basic system backup and restore functions.
- Must have experience with and/or be familiar with SALT, Ansible, Splunk, Puppet, SolarWinds, Nessus.
- Must have experience with and/or have knowledge of Red Hat 7 and 8, and VMWare.
- Must have experience with Apache Tomcat, IIS, and/or SQL server database.
- Must have experience documenting and providing information for security accreditation and certification.
- Must have a solid understanding of advanced security protocols and standards.
- Must have experience with Network Security Technologies (e.g. Multiple Domain, PKI, SSP, and Vulnerability Assessment).
- Must have experience with High Assurance platforms and application integration testing methods.
- Must have experience with both Client and Server virtualization environments.
- Must be able to lift up to 50 lbs.
- Must have experience with installation, configuration, troubleshooting, and reimaging hardware.
- Must have experience with disk arrays, PowerShell and PowerCLI, KVMs,
- Must have knowledge of PKI systems which use HSMs to validate key and NTP for synchronization.
- Must have experience optimizing system operations.
- Must have a solid understanding of information security principles and practices.
- Must have experience with or familiarity with software and security architectures.
- Must have experience or familiarity with the following systems: Windows/Linux operating systems, VMware, and Networking: Switches, Routers, LANs, & cabling.
- Must be able to support occasional day or short duration travel, if needed.
- Must possess a TS/SCI clearance with appropriate polygraph
- Bachelor's Degree or Master's degree in System Engineering, Computer Science, Information Systems, Engineering Science, Engineering Management, or a related technical field.
- Proficiency with SQL Server desired.
